    I've been to quite a few shows, thought I would never see a 'Burgh show better than my first in 98, but the band and crowd blew me away on this one. Absolutely amazing! Black was completely moving & gorgeous & I cried too during the tag, also a lovely Daughter tag, first Marker in the Sand for me this tour, best Porch I've ever heard, a most unexpected Smile.... and Rockin in the Free World on fire!! (I have so much love for Stone...so much love.)

    So Ed said Pittsburgh wasn't one of their favorite places... he DID say it was one of their favorite places to play. I actually laughed when he said that and he looked around with a pause before saying the rest, what a joker. The band seemed in excellent spirits, looked like everyone was having fun, I loved every song and dear god they sounded great!

    Nice nice show. Highlights for me were preset Throw Your Arms Around Me - Ed's voice was SO clear and it was beautiful! Smile - my first time hearing it, in 21 shows! The unexpected Waiting on a Friend - very cool, then Man of the Hour; Comatose continues to be a favorite live, and Severed Hand and WWS. In Hiding AGAIN! :D RITW was really energetic. I said so in another thread, but Black was so heartfelt, and the words of the tag and how Ed was during the tag really made me wonder if he was thinking about Johnny then.... words like apart forever.... I liked Robert Pollard - I'd never heard any of his stuff before.
